Celebrity Big Brother star Louis Walsh looked less than impressed as the crowd booed and chanted during the live eviction.

On Tuesday night, things got tense as the live eviction loomed over the Big Brother house. Towards the end of the episode, hosts AJ Odudu and Will Best hyped up the crowd as they revealed the three stars up for eviction - presenter Fern Britton, TV personality Lauren Simon and X Factor judge Louis.

The camera panned across the three stars' faces, starting with Fern and Lauren who seemed nervous but happy as they smiled at the camera. However, as AJ yelled out Louis' name and the camera panned towards him, a large percentage of the crowd started booing and chanting: "Get Louis out!"

Louis seemed displeased by the booing, and by being up for eviction, as he kept a straight face and tried his best not to react to the tense moment. Luckily for Louis, the Real Housewives of Cheshire star Lauren was the celebrity chosen to be evicted after a dramatic few days.

It comes after Louis slammed Jedward in a chat with Colson Smith earlier in the episode. The 71-year-old music manager was a judge on The X Factor in 2009 when Irish twins John and Edward Grimes, 32, were contestants. As part of the groups, Louis was in charge of Jedward and championed them to win the series - however, they bombed out in the sixth week while Joe McElderry, 32, went on to win the show.

He managed the duo until 2013 before they went their separate ways. Coronation Street star Colson asked Louis about his time on The X Factor. He said: "What were Jedward like?” and much to the shock of fans, Louis got straight to the point and said: “They were vile.” Colson gasped and then said: “But they’ve done well.”

Louis didn't stop there as he went on to make the shocking revelation that he managed to make millions out of managing the brothers - but that didn’t sweeten his opinion of them. He said: “I got five million quid for them. I swear on my mother’s life.” Colson then added: “F**king hell. I wish I had a Jedward.”

But Louis only doubled down. He said: “And they were vile. They were a novelty. But great for the show.” Jedward quickly caught wind of the comment and took to X, formerly known as Twitter, to slam their former manager and brand him a "cold-hearted b*****d."

"Louis Walsh is a cold-hearted b*****d who didn’t even send us flowers when our mom died," they posted to their 641,000 followers.
